11 Highgrove Ct, Andrews Farm SA 5114, Australia
5114 Adelaide
Australia
+61 426 178 786
info@lsdetailing.com.au
lsdetailing.com.au
Unfortunatly we cant show the content of this page without login. Please sign up and try again.